Modern fuel, with bio methanol plus other corrosive elements can play havoc with an older fuel system designed to use older, purer petroleum.
Failure to drain the carburettor for the winter lay up allows the fuel to turn into varnish, blocking the jets and coating the float and float chamber, sometimes to the point where it becomes so difficult to clear, replacement of the affected parts may give preferable results?
